The Spy Game: Trump's Gamble with Intelligence Leadership

The world of political intrigue and intelligence operations is heating up in Washington, as President Trump's controversial decision to appoint Bill Pulte as the acting Director of National Intelligence (DNI) sparks a bipartisan backlash. With the clock ticking towards a potential lapse in critical spy powers, the stakes are high and the consequences far-reaching.

A Temporary Pick, Permanent Controversy

Personally, I find it intriguing that Trump has chosen to double down on Pulte, a federal housing regulator with limited intelligence experience. This move has set off a chain reaction of events, with Democrats drawing a line in the sand and refusing to support the renewal of Section 702 of the Foreign Intelligence Surveillance Act (FISA), a vital tool for gathering intelligence abroad. The Battle in Congress

The drama unfolds in Congress, with Senate Republicans proposing a short-term FISA extension, only to be swiftly rejected by Democrats. The House, led by Speaker Mike Johnson, prepares for a vote on a stopgap measure, but the odds are stacked against it. This political tug-of-war showcases the deep divisions and the difficulty of finding common ground, even on matters of national security.

FISA's Future: Hanging in the Balance

Section 702 of FISA, a powerful tool for agencies like the CIA and NSA, is at the heart of this debate. While privacy concerns have always been a factor, the recent bipartisan compromise to renew it seemed like a win for national security. However, Pulte's appointment has thrown a wrench into the works, with key figures like Senator Mark Warner calling it a 'live hand grenade'.
